    National Guard questions.

    Where can I find what units there are in my area? Also can you only get a MOS that is needed in your area? I'm not sure on how this works or does there have to be a unit in your area for that MOS? I'm mostly interested in 19D,21B, and 31B.

            Originally posted by ChrisO
            Where can I find what units there are in my area? Also can you only get a MOS that is needed in your area? I'm not sure on how this works or does there have to be a unit in your area for that MOS? I'm mostly interested in 19D,21B, and 31B.
            Where you go depends on what you quailfy for and how far you are willing to drive to get what you want. I'm Air National Guard and some people in my unit drive 6 hours to get to the base for our UTA weekends. If you want to find out what units are in your area call the local recuiting office or....
